Calories in Weis, Reduced Sodium Boneless Ham Steak

📏 Serving Size: 1 Serving (85.0g)

🧪 Nutrition Facts

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 109.7
  • Total Fat 4.0 g
  • Saturated Fat 1.5 g
  • Cholesterol 45.1 mg
  • Sodium 489.6 mg
  • Potassium 0.0 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 1.0 g
  • Dietary Fiber 0.0 g
  • Sugars 0.0 g
  • Protein 16.0 g

📝 Ingredients

Cured with: Water, Salt, Potassium Chloride, Sodium Phosphate, Sugar, Sodium Bicarbonate, Hydrolyzed Soy Protein, Dextrose, Sodium Erythorbate, Sodium Nitrate.

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Weis, Reduced Sodium Boneless Ham Steak

Is Weis, Reduced Sodium Boneless Ham Steak good for weight loss?

With just 110 calories and 16g of protein per serving, this ham steak can support weight loss by keeping you feeling full without excess calories. The high protein-to-calorie ratio makes it a practical choice for maintaining satiety on a calorie-controlled diet.

Is Weis, Reduced Sodium Boneless Ham Steak good for muscle building?

The 16g of protein per 85g serving provides meaningful support for muscle repair and growth, making this a solid protein source for strength training. While not exceptionally high in absolute terms, it's nutrient-dense and low in calories, so it fits well into a muscle-building meal plan.

Is Weis, Reduced Sodium Boneless Ham Steak heart-healthy?

The saturated fat content is quite low at 1.5g per serving, and cholesterol is moderate at 45mg, which are both favorable for heart health. However, the sodium level and processed nature of cured ham mean it's best enjoyed occasionally rather than regularly as part of a heart-conscious diet.

How does Weis, Reduced Sodium Boneless Ham Steak fit a low-sodium diet?

This product won't work well for a low-sodium diet despite the 'reduced sodium' label—490mg per serving is substantial and approaches a quarter of many people's daily sodium targets. You'd need to account for this carefully if sodium restriction is important for your health.

What should I watch out for with Weis, Reduced Sodium Boneless Ham Steak?

Even though this is labeled 'reduced sodium,' at nearly 490mg per serving it's still moderately high in sodium—about 21% of the daily limit. The ingredient list includes multiple sodium-containing additives (phosphate, erythorbate, nitrate), so this shouldn't be a daily staple if you're watching overall sodium intake.
